How they compare
Iceland currently reports 2,575 against 2,564 in Fiji, a difference of 11.
Across all 26 years both countries report, Iceland has been ahead every year.
Fiji ranks 162nd and Iceland ranks 161st of 205 countries.
Iceland has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Fiji | Iceland |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 1,408 | 2,282 | 874 | Iceland |
| 2000s | 1,724 | 2,540 | 816 | Iceland |
| 2010s | 1,393 | 2,775 | 1,382 | Iceland |
| 2020s | 1,600 | 2,693 | 1,094 | Iceland |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
